This is a 1 hour pre-recorded webinar tailored for physical therapists, physical therapist assistants, and students aiming to expand their clinical knowledge in the assessment and rehabilitation of Achilles tendinopathy. The session covers anatomical and pathophysiological distinctions between mid-portion and insertional tendinopathy, mechanisms of injury, systemic risk factors, and evidence-based rehabilitation principles. Key strength and mobility assessments - including dorsiflexion range of motion and calf muscle testing-are demonstrated using handheld dynamometry. A real-world case study highlights interpretation of findings, clinical reasoning, and formulation of a progressive intervention plan. Additional discussion includes load management, recovery strategies, and the role of systemic health.
